What Are FATF Virtual Asset Guidelines?
FATF virtual asset guidelines refer to the international standards set by the Financial Action Task Force for cryptocurrencies and digital assets. These guidelines require virtual asset service providers (VASPs) to implement robust Know Your Customer (KYC) procedures, maintain transaction records, and share information with relevant authorities. The framework treats virtual assets similarly to traditional financial instruments, ensuring that digital currencies operate within a regulated environment.
Key Requirements for Virtual Asset Service Providers
VASPs must comply with several critical requirements under FATF guidelines. These include conducting thorough customer due diligence, monitoring transactions for suspicious activity, and maintaining detailed records for at least five years. Service providers must also implement effective risk assessment procedures and report any suspicious transactions to the appropriate financial intelligence unit. Additionally, VASPs are required to establish clear policies and procedures for compliance with anti-money laundering (AML) regulations.
Impact on Cryptocurrency Privacy and Transactions
The implementation of FATF guidelines has significantly affected cryptocurrency privacy and transaction practices. While these regulations enhance security and legitimacy in the crypto space, they also reduce the anonymity traditionally associated with digital currencies. Users must now provide identification information when using major exchanges and platforms, and transactions can be traced more easily by authorities. This has led to the development of new privacy-focused solutions and increased interest in decentralized exchanges that may operate outside traditional regulatory frameworks.
